  The transport sector, with its vast network of vehicles and operations, stands at the heart of global environmental concerns. Among these, the rail industry is considered a relatively sustainable mode of transportation, especially when compared to road and air travel. However, there remains room for significant improvements, particularly in reducing the environmental impact of braking systems. Train braking solutions, often overlooked, are crucial to achieving sustainability in rail operations. Traditional braking methods tend to rely heavily on friction, leading to particulate emissions and excessive energy consumption. Fortunately, advancements in technology are paving the way for more eco-friendly alternatives that can substantially mitigate these issues.
